Achieve Advanced Rooftop Control via two-wire installation and seven onboard IAQ sensors

Product Features:

  • Advanced Control Features: includes a dual-enthalpy economizer, demand-control ventilation (DCV), and variable-frequency drive (VFD) control.
  • Rapid Deployment for ARC Performance: Plug-and-Play solution for Advanced Rooftop Control via two-wire installation for the thermistor to report temperature to the RTU.
  • Intelligent Alerts for Optimal System Health: condensate overflow and dirty filter sensors with notifications for advanced alerts.
  • Real-Time Insight: enjoy access to sensor data for all seven onboard sensors (temperature, humidity, light, sound, CO2, occupancy, and particulate matter) and remote control over building parameters through Airoverse’s building intelligence suite of web and mobile apps.
  • Wireless Network, Uncompromising Security: a secure and proprietary encrypted 900 MHz wireless mesh network allows for lightweight, reliable communications between devices and eliminates the need to run wires throughout a space.
  • Eight Control Relays: flexible relay assignments for controlling a range of existing HVAC equipment.
  • Four Analog Outputs: localized damper control for granular demand control ventilation.

SPECIFICATIONS:

HYPERLITE

Mechanical Specifications:

Dimensions: 165mm x 115mm x 29mm (6.5″ x 4.5″ x 1.15″)

Screen:  2.8” 240×320 pixel TFT LCD

Mounting: two (2) screws in drywall

Operating Temp: -4° F to 122° F (-17° C to 50° C)

Electrical Specifications:

Power: 24V AC/DC (+/- 15%) with a nominal power consumption of 1.0W and maximum consumption of 2.5W

Communication Specifications:

Bluetooth: BLE 4.1; used during commissioning

Mesh: 900 MHz IEEE 802.15.4-compliant; used for device communication on mesh network

Wired: 4-wire RS-485 interface; 3-wire connector for low-power sensor bus

Accuracy & Range Specifications:

Temperature: Operating range between -4° F to 122° F (-20° C to 50° C); typical accuracy of +/- 1° F or 0.2° C

Humidity: Operating range between 20 to 85% noncondensing; typical accuracy of +/- 2% RH

Dedicated CO2 Sensor: Range 0-40,000 ppm; accuracy +/- 30 ppm over range of 400-10,000 ppm with a lifetime of 15 years

Light: Ambient light sensor; high-accuracy UV index sensor; matches erythemal curve; < 100 mix resolution

Sound: 40-120 dB response for 100 Hz to 10 KHz

Occupancy: Passive Infra Red (PIR) with a detection range of 4m with 30-degree angle

Optional PM2.5, PM10 Sensor: Detection range of 0-1000 ug/m3 and accuracy of +/- 10 ug/m3 (PM2.5, 0-100 ug/m3) or +/- 25ug/m3 (PM10, 0-100 ug/m3)

CONNECT MODULE

Mechanical Specifications:

Dimensions: 140mm x 105mm x 31mm (5.5″ x 4.13″ x 1.22″)

Screen:  TFT LCD, 1.77″, 128 (RGB)* 160 px

Mounting: Wall

I/O SPECIFICATIONS:

Inputs: A. (8) Universal inputs; B. (1) Sensor Bus

Outputs: C. (4) 0-10V DC or 4-20 mA analog outputs; D. (8) relays rated at 1A, 120 V AC or 24 V AC/DC resistive load

Electrical Specifications:

Power: 24V AC/DC (+/- 15%) with a nominal power consumption of 1.0W and maximum consumption of 2.5W

Communication Specifications:

Bluetooth: Available for future use

Wired:

  • Modbus RTU/BACnet over RS485 communication
  • Sensor Bus
  • Power over RS485 to enable communication with the HyperLite and the power unit over standard thermostat wires
  • Dedicated Modbus/BACnet MSTP ports to interface with third-party BMS devices
